1 INTRODUCTION
Today’s businesses face unprecedented challenges and
changes. Globalization is creating worldwide competition
for resources, talent, and products, (Oracle 2010). Besides
that, Competitive intelligence has undergone a raising
interest in recent years as a result of the information
explosion and the sharpness of information technologies,
(Paraschiv et al., and 2009).and adds that, Competitiveness
is a natural relationship between businesses. Business
competitors are other organizations offering the same
product or service in the present time but also in the future
and also organizations that could remove the need for a
product or service by offering substitutes or changing
habits.
And according to Atem et al.,(2007) that customers
yearning for continuous increase in quality and a
corresponding decrease in price and delivery time,
prevailing business strategies would always be unreliable
to meet consumers’ satisfaction. Organisations are always
under immense pressure to meet the requirements of their
stakeholders.
